An Oracle-only Linux kernel coming?

While Suse Linux has released Oracle-friendly release of their Linux kernel, we now see that Oracle is considering their own Oracle-owned Linux environment:

http://news.ft.com/cms/s/7354696c-cd86-11da-afcd-0000779e2340.html

Oracle is studying whether to launch its own version of the Linux operating system and has looked at buying one of the two companies currently dominating the Linux world, according to Larry Ellison, the software company’s chief executive officer.

Such a move would redraw the software landscape and open a new front in Oracle’s long rivalry with US rival Microsoft.

The article notes that much of this is an attempt to counteract the influence of Microsoft Windows, (an operating system originally designed for personal computers):

Like IBM, Oracle has counted on Linux – an open source system whose code is open to anyone to view and adapt – to act as a counterweight to Microsoft’s Windows, which has expanded rapidly from desktop PCs into corporate IT systems.

As part of a recent study of the open source software market, Mr Ellison said that Oracle had considered buying Novell, which after Red Hat is the biggest distributor of Linux. “We look at everything, play this thing out,” he added.
